First BOSS Strong Championship to shape future Soldiers functional fitness
September 14, 2017
— Teams of America's rugged professionals -- U.S. Army Soldiers from across the globe -- have converged on San Antonio from Sept. 11-24 to determine who best represents readiness, fitness, and resilience. Five teams of six Soldiers began the BOSS Strong Championship Sept. 11 at Retama Park, competing in a sequence of daily events that measure application of the five healthy aspects of Army life: physical, mental, emotional, social, and spiritual well-being...
